About Smile on Seniors
For more than 15 years, Smile On Seniors has brought friendship, meaningful programs and Jewish connection to active adults and seniors throughout Greater Phoenix.
Whether you're looking to meet new people, enjoy engaging programs, strengthen your Jewish connection or simply feel more connected, there's a place for you at SOS.

Daily Thought
Every year, our sages taught, with the cry of the shofar, the entire universe is reborn.
And so, at that time, with our resolutions and our prayers, we hold an awesome power: To determine what sort of child this newborn year shall be—how it will take its first breaths, how it will struggle to its feet, and how it will carry us through life for the twelve months to come.
In truth, it is not only once a year. At every new moon, in a smaller way, all life is renewed again.
And so too, every morning, we are all reborn from a nighttime taste of death.
